Materials Used in Scent Beads
The composition of scent beads can vary depending on the manufacturer and the specific product. However, most scent beads are made from a combination of the following materials:
The primary component of scent beads is typically a porous polymer, such as a polyethylene or polypropylene. These materials provide the necessary structure and porosity for the beads to absorb and release fragrance oils. The polymer is usually in the form of small, spherical beads, which are then infused with fragrance oils.
In addition to the polymer, scent beads may also contain fragrance oils, which are the essential component of the product. Fragrance oils are a mixture of essential oils, aroma compounds, and other ingredients that provide the desired scent. The type and concentration of fragrance oils used can vary greatly depending on the specific product and the intended application.
Some scent beads may also contain additives, such as fixatives, stabilizers, and UV protectants. These additives help to enhance the fragrance, improve the stability of the product, and protect the beads from degradation caused by light and heat.

The Manufacturing Process of Scent Beads
The manufacturing process of scent beads involves several steps, including the production of the polymer beads, infusion with fragrance oils, and packaging. Here is an overview of the manufacturing process:
The first step in the production of scent beads is the creation of the polymer beads. This involves the use of a process called extrusion, where the polymer material is melted and formed into small, spherical beads. The beads are then cooled and sorted according to size and shape.
The next step is the infusion of the polymer beads with fragrance oils. This involves the use of a process called absorption, where the fragrance oils are absorbed into the porous polymer beads. The beads are typically placed in a container with the fragrance oils, where they are allowed to absorb the oils over a period of time.
Once the beads have been infused with fragrance oils, they are packaged and prepared for distribution. The packaging may include a small bag or container, as well as instructions for use.
The Science Behind Scent Beads
Scent beads work by slowly releasing fragrance oils into the air. The fragrance oils are absorbed into the porous polymer beads, where they are stored until they are released. The release of fragrance oils is controlled by the porosity of the polymer beads, as well as the type and concentration of fragrance oils used.
The fragrance-release mechanism of scent beads is based on the principles of diffusion and adsorption. The fragrance oils are absorbed into the polymer beads, where they are stored in the pores and on the surface of the beads. As the beads are exposed to air, the fragrance oils are slowly released through the process of diffusion, where they migrate from an area of high concentration to an area of low concentration.
The rate of fragrance release can be controlled by adjusting the porosity of the polymer beads, as well as the type and concentration of fragrance oils used. For example, a higher porosity bead will release fragrance oils more quickly, while a lower porosity bead will release fragrance oils more slowly.
Factors Affecting the Fragrance-Release Mechanism
There are several factors that can affect the fragrance-release mechanism of scent beads, including:
Temperature: The rate of fragrance release can be affected by temperature. Higher temperatures can increase the rate of fragrance release, while lower temperatures can decrease the rate of fragrance release.
Humidity: The rate of fragrance release can also be affected by humidity. Higher humidity can increase the rate of fragrance release, while lower humidity can decrease the rate of fragrance release.
Air flow: The rate of fragrance release can be affected by air flow. Increased air flow can increase the rate of fragrance release, while decreased air flow can decrease the rate of fragrance release.

How are scent beads made?
The manufacturing process for scent beads typically involves several steps, including the production of the polymer or resin base, the infusion of the fragrance or essential oil, and the shaping and sizing of the beads. The polymer or resin base is typically produced through a process known as extrusion, which involves melting the raw materials and shaping them into a long, thin rope. The rope is then cut into small pieces, which are then infused with the fragrance or essential oil.
The infusion process involves mixing the fragrance or essential oil with the polymer or resin base, allowing it to be evenly distributed throughout the bead. This can be done through a variety of methods, including spraying, dipping, or tumbling. Once the fragrance or essential oil has been infused into the bead, the beads are then shaped and sized to the desired specifications. This can involve rolling, tumbling, or other processes to give the beads their final shape and size. The finished beads are then packaged and shipped to manufacturers or consumers for use in a variety of applications.
